What’s in a Name
The name “ugg” (which is also sometimes spelled as ugg, ugh and ug) is a generic term in Australia used to describe this style of sheepskin boots. It actually does come from the Australian slang word, “ugly.” But while any style sheepskin boot may be called an ugg, only the ones available through UGG® Australia are the original, luxury item that everyone seems to crave.
The fact that the name “ugg” is widely used in Australia, and also now in the United States, has caused much controversy for the Deckers Outdoor Corporation, which runs UGG® Australia today and has trademarked the name. The Deckers Corp. has demanded that other companies no longer be allowed to use this name. However, many competitors continue to advertise other brand boots as “uggs” anyway, making it confusing for consumers to weed through the choices – many of which look alike – but aren’t made from the same high-quality material.
The advice most experts offer to would-be ugg owners is only to buy directly from the UGG® Australia website or from another approved UGG® Australia retailer (you can find a list of stores on the Ugg Boots website). Nordstrom also carries a wide selection of the line.

How Uggs Began
Australian ugg-style boots date back as far as about 200 years, but they didn’t really came to the forefront of the fashion scene until the 1970s when Australian surfers began buying uggs because of their practical properties. UGG® Australia boots are made of premium sheepskin that has been specially treated for extra softness. Since sheepskin is thermostatic, it regulates the body temperature and can keep the body comfortable even at 30 degrees below zero, according to some experts. It also breathes naturally, keeping moisture away from the body.
Recognizing these important benefits, an Australian surfer named Brian Smith brought a bag of Australian ugg boots with him to California and introduced American surfers to the style, sparking the new craze and supporting the creation of the ugh or UGG® Australia brand. In 1995, the brand was sold to Deckers Outdoor Corporation, which continued to develop and grow the product line, turning it into a luxury item. The company was able to convince Nordstrom to stock the line in the early 2000s, and in 2003, Footwear News named this “Brand of the Year,” causing interest in the boots to explode. The rest was history, as the ugly slipper shoe quickly became a regular sight on feet all across America.

A Word of Warning
While uggs are comfortable to walk in and pillows your feet in warmth and softness, it also does little to cushion your feet with support. Therefore, this can be a problem for your arches, tendons and ankles, some podiatrists warn users. They recommend if you must wear this style, at least save it for short-term periods of use and not for heavy walking. In addition, keep in mind that uggs aren’t actually waterproof, making them a less than ideal choice for heavy rain and snow. These facts don’t seem to deter ugg fans, though, who think these negatives are far outweighed by the positives.
How to Tell the Real Thing
When it comes to buying UGG boots, there are numerous fakes you may encounter, particularly if you order online. You should know that the genuine boots have the name UGG embossed in the bottom. The fake ones usually have the name just written, but the letters are not raised. The fakes also tend to have uneven stitching, are made of poor quality material and have a slight odor to them that doesn’t go away. Major department chains such as Nordstrom, Macy’s or the Ugg Australia website itself are all good sources to ensure you are getting what you are paying for.
What It Costs
If you want to get in on this widespread trend, you may wonder what it will cost you. Prices for women’s boots start at about $120 for the most basic design. Some of the other variations go up from there. A tall calf “romantic” style design runs around $200, with a variety of low and high-styles priced in between this range. Cost For UggsBoots adorned with fancy fleece cuffs are in the $200 to $230 range, while other riding and motorcycle-inspired looks can be found for between $200 and $300, depending on what you select. Men’s uggs range from about $130 to $200, while toddler and children’s uggs generally cost between $100 and $140. You can even find pre-walker uggs for your baby, too. These are about $50 for a miniature cozy pair. You can also find limited edition uggs available now only through the UGG Australia website. These range from $260 to $300. In addition, if you prefer to keep your ugg-wear confined to the privacy of your home, there are a variety of ugg slippers that sell for between $60 and $100 for adults, or around $50 for kids. Finally, if you have more unlimited money to “wear,” you can also invest in the luxurious sheepskin Ugg coats, which cost between $1,000 and $2,200.
So you can expect to spend between $120 and $300 for men and women’s UGG® Australia footwear, with adult slippers and baby/toddler styles starting at $50, while Ugg coats can cost as much as $2,200.
